## Description SAIT’s Finance department loves an equation — so we’re looking to add to our team. Tasked with ensuring the institution’s financial health, we bring diligence, accuracy and a customer-focused approach to the work we do. Join us as we work together to ensure SAIT is well positioned to meet current and future needs.  The Opportunity   Job classification: A5006 - Senior Purchasing Officer Salary range: $67,100.80 - $87,443.20 Placement within the range is typically based upon a review of skills, experience, and internal equity.  Hours per week: 40 Paid leave: 3 weeks vacation per year Deadline to apply: 4:00PM, May 19th, 2026   Reporting to the Team Lead, Supply Management, the Senior Purchasing Officer is responsible for the procurement of a wide variety of commodities, materials, supplies, equipment, and services for the SAIT community, Within this role, the incumbent will demonstrate a high level of accountability, skill and understanding relating to the application of a variety of procurement applications, processes, standards and procedures, including “best value” competitive bidding and negotiation.   This position will ensure all procurement activity being performed is in accordance with SAIT and applicable government procurement regulations, guidelines and procedures.    The incumbent will promote and maintain a high level of communication and liaison with internal SAIT schools, departments, stakeholders and with the external supplier community.   In order to be successful in this role, the selected incumbent must possess the ability to understand and incorporate technology and internal control processes with business practices. Excellent computer system and relationship building skills, and a strong understanding of procurement, internal controls and associated financial processes are required. ## How you'll contribute Procure a variety of supplies, services and equipment required for the overall operations of SAIT.
